Edinburgh Airport expansion ‘would boost economy by £867m’
02.09.09
Expansion plans that could see 26 million passengers passing through Edinburgh Airport by 2030 would support 16,000 jobs and provide an annual boost of £867 million for the Scottish economy, a new report by Scottish Enterprise and airport owner BAA found.
The report suggests that the airport's masterplan, which was published in 2006, has the potential to provide a huge boost for the countries economy. A spokesman said that it is ‘critical’ in helping the Capital's financial services sector weather the recession.
